USAGE SUMMARY

"complete evaluation" is a grammatically correct and commonly used phrase in written English.
It usually refers to a comprehensive assessment or analysis of something. You can use it when discussing a detailed and thorough examination of a subject, idea, situation, or person. Here is an example: "After conducting a complete evaluation of the company's financial records, the auditors discovered several discrepancies."

FAQs

How can I use "complete evaluation" in a sentence?

You might say, "The doctor recommended a "complete evaluation" to determine the cause of the patient's symptoms" or "The company needs to conduct a "complete evaluation" of its marketing strategy".

What are some alternatives to "complete evaluation"?

Depending on the context, you could use alternatives like "thorough assessment", "comprehensive assessment", or "full assessment".

What does a "complete evaluation" typically include?

A "complete evaluation" usually includes gathering all relevant information, analyzing it thoroughly, and drawing well-supported conclusions.

Is there a difference between a "complete evaluation" and a "partial evaluation"?

Yes, a "complete evaluation" aims to assess all relevant aspects, while a partial evaluation focuses only on certain parts or aspects of the subject.
